nginx-module-srcache
Transparent subrequest-based caching layout for arbitrary NGINX locations
Description
This module provides a transparent caching layer for arbitrary NGINX locations (like those use an upstream or even serve static disk files). The caching behavior is mostly compatible with RFC 2616. To enable this module after installation, add the following to /etc/nginx/nginx.conf and reload NGINX: load_module modules/ngx_http_srcache_filter_module.so; Alternatively, you can enable all installed modules by placing this line at the top of /etc/nginx/nginx.conf: include /usr/share/nginx/modules/*.conf;
